Why SDIC Outperforms Traditional Chlorine Solutions

Let’s cut through the noise: when it comes to chlorine-based water treatment, SDIC isn’t just another option—it’s the superior choice. With an active chlorine content of 60-65% compared to 30-40% in conventional chlorine products, SDIC delivers more disinfection power per kilogram. But the real magic lies in its stability. Unlike traditional chlorine compounds that degrade rapidly, SDIC’s unique molecular structure ensures consistent chlorine release over extended periods.

I’ve seen countless wholesalers struggle with inconsistent water quality due to unstable chlorine products. SDIC solves this by maintaining effective disinfection levels for up to 48 hours in pool applications, reducing the need for frequent dosing. This stability translates directly to operational savings—your customers get cleaner water with fewer chemical additions, while you secure repeat business through reliable performance.

Q: What are the storage requirements for bulk SDIC?
A: SDIC should be st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and incompatible materials. Our packaging includes moisture barriers and oxygen absorbers, but we recommend storage below 25°C for optimal stability. We provide detailed storage guidelines with every shipment.

Q: Can SDIC be used in all types of water treatment applications?
A: SDIC is versatile and suitable for municipal water treatment, swimming pools, spas, industrial wastewater, and aquaculture. However, dosage and application methods vary by use case. Our technical team provides specific recommendations based on your application needs.
